The Marsden M-900 is a portable, 600kg capacity bed scale. Features two weigh beams, 200g accuracy, BMI calculation, and fold-out ramps. Class III Approved.

The Marsden M-900 is the definitive professional solution for weighing bed-bound patients with dignity and clinical precision. Designed for high-dependency environments such as intensive care units, renal wards, and hospices, this Class III Approved system eliminates the need for distressing patient transfers or the use of hoists.

By utilizing two independent, low-profile weigh beams, the M-900 allows healthcare staff to roll a bed directly onto the scale. With its massive 600kg capacity, the system is engineered to handle everything from standard hospital trolleys to heavy-duty bariatric beds with ease.

Precision Engineering for High-Dependency Care

The M-900 provides the accuracy required for the practice of medicine, where precise weight data is critical for fluid balance monitoring and medication dosing.

  • Massive 600kg Capacity: Specifically built to accommodate bariatric beds and their occupants safely.

  • Clinical Accuracy: Delivers high-resolution 200g graduations, ensuring even minor weight fluctuations are captured for medical records.

  • Innovative Fold-Out Ramps: Each beam features integrated, gentle-incline ramps that fold out for use, allowing beds with various wheel sizes to be positioned smoothly onto the scale.

Advanced Features for Clinical Efficiency

Equipped with a premium multi-screen indicator and full numeric keypad, the M-650 streamlines the weighing process:

  • Simultaneous Data Display: Three clear LCD screens show Weight, Height, and BMI at once, reducing the time spent toggling through menus.

  • Intelligent Tare & Preset Tare: Instantly subtract the weight of the bed. Using Preset Tare, clinicians can store the weights of standard ward beds, ensuring the display only shows the patient’s net weight.

  • Hold Technology: The “Hold” function stabilizes and locks the reading on the display, allowing the clinician to focus on the patient before recording the data.

Mobile Versatility & Digital Readiness

Despite its heavy-duty performance, the M-900 is remarkably easy for a single member of staff to transport and store:

  • Ward Mobility: Each beam weighs approximately 11.5kg and is fitted with integrated wheels and ergonomic handles. The beams can be stored vertically, making them ideal for facilities with limited floor space.

  • Uninterrupted Power: The internal rechargeable battery provides up to 55 hours of continuous use (approximately 3,000 weigh-ins). A 12V 1A mains adaptor is included for stationary use or recharging.

  • Future-Proof Connectivity: A standard data port is included for printers, with optional Bluetooth or Wi-Fi connectivity available to transmit patient weight data directly to Electronic Medical Record (EMR) systems.

The International Organization of Legal Metrology (OIML) has established standards for the classification of calibration test weights. Varying from E0 & E1, which are the most accurate to M2 which are commonly used for calibrating platform scales, floor scales and other industrial weighing instruments.

As a rough guide we have listed desired accuracy against class below.

+/- 0.1% – UNclassed Proof Load Test Weights
+/- 0.05% – M3 (Check/calibrate coarse scales)
+/- 0.005% – M1 (Check/calibrate standard scales)
+/- 0.0015% – F2 (Check/calibrate portable balances)
+/- 0.0005% – F1 (Check/calibrate precision balances)
+/- 0.00015% – E2 (Check/calibrate analytical balances)

The choice of weight class depends on the intended use and the level of accuracy required for a particular application. If you’re unsure, talk to our team who can advise you on the right class for your equipment.

If you’re sending a scale back to us for recalibration, it is ideal to use the original packaging. If this is not available choose a sturdy well-padded box to avoid shocks. Where possible, protect the load sensor by removing the weighing pan and any under-pan support and pack these separately in the box. You may be able to use the equipment’s locking pins or screws too.

Do ensure all the paperwork, including your contact details, is included to ensure we can return it once calibration is complete.
